The word "poke" (pronounced poh-kay) originates from Hawaii and means “to slice” or “to cut crosswise into pieces.” A poke bowl traditionally features raw, cubed fish seasoned with a variety of sauces and served over rice with toppings.
Not all tuna is created equal. Selecting high-quality, sushi-grade tuna is essential for flavor and safety.

Proper preparation is key to creating a safe and flavorful dish.
Pro Tip:
Always use a separate cutting board and knife for raw fish to prevent cross-contamination.
